Transaction 319bf91be025d5f496846cdf2a895e4781a795510279034558f0efb914bd9dba
1 Input
2 Outputs
- 319bf91be025d5f496846cdf2a895e4781a795510279034558f0efb914bd9dba:0
- 319bf91be025d5f496846cdf2a895e4781a795510279034558f0efb914bd9dba:1
value 105822793
address 1Ag2uaRLK4zMsay9pvR6ZmfWHy2huZMCef
value 11620794074
address 37zfKL5EqsokYztEj6yrJxeJah52CgJixG